- Q2750641 abstract "Harry Leland, also known as the Black Bishop, is a fictional supervillain who appears in comic books published by Marvel Comics and an adversary of the X-Men.Leland possesses the mutant ability to increase the mass of an object or person, making it extremely heavy. Thanks to his allegiance to Sebastian Shaw, he attained the rank of "Black Bishop," of the Lords Cardinal of the New York branch of The Hellfire Club, an exclusive secret society bent on world domination. In civilian life, he was a corporate lawyer.".
